## Ticket: Cold-storage archiver misconfiguration (Glacierbin)

The nightly Glacierbin archiver skipped three cold-storage buckets last week because staging's env file was copied to prod without updating credentials, so writes to the Permafrost tier silently failed. Proposed fix for the sync: regenerate prod's env file from the vault template and add a startup check that rejects staging-scoped tokens. The Permafrost write secret is set on the line immediately below.

vault entry, kafog-yahop: COURIER_KEY8=0faa53ae

After upgrading Lintharbor to the 5.x ruleset, the old baseline file in `quality/baseline.xml` is no longer valid and must be regenerated. Delete the existing file before running the scan, otherwise suppressed findings from the 4.x era will mask genuine regressions. Reviewers should confirm the new baseline contains only pre-existing debt and no findings introduced by this migration branch. The regeneration job reads its thresholds and exclusion paths from the service configuration, reproduced below for reference.

config for tagep-yajef:
ulawyn:
  log_level: error
  metrics_host: metrics.ulawyn.lumiclabs.internal
  pin: 0564
  pool_size: 32

### Action Item: Spoolhaven Retry Storm

From last Tuesday's outage: the Spoolhaven print service retried failed jobs without backoff, saturating the render pool. Fix merged; retries now use capped exponential backoff with jitter. Owner will monitor for a week before closing. The agreed retry constants are recorded below.

constants for yadup-kajof:
RATE_LIMITS = {
    "zorwyn": 1,
    "druwyn": 1,
}